The Pearson Yachts 30 is a 9.1-meter masthead sloop designed by William H. Shaw and built by Pearson Yachts from 1971 to 1981. Over 1,000 units were produced, making it one of Pearson's most successful models. The boat has a fin keel with a spade rudder, a beam of 2.9 meters, a draft of 1.5 meters, and a displacement of 3773 kg. Early models were equipped with Palmer inboards. The Pearson Yachts 30 is considered a structurally sound fiberglass hull from the 1970s and 1980s production boom, with common issues relating to bolted-on components like sails, rigging, and engines rather than the hull itself.
